Reggae Radio Stations: The hip and groovy reggae music genre is a blend of several music styles, like African and Jamaican music, American R&B, ska and mento. Reggae is characterized by a heavy backbeat rhythm, a feature of the African-based music.
Since the time it was adopted, reggae has been a great hit on the radio. In the earlier days of radio, the sound systems and stations were high powered. Reggae radio stations from Florida and New Orleans could be aired in Jamaica.

Online Reggae Radio Stations: Online reggae radio stations feature a host of options. You have the choice of listening to the original reggae of the 60’s and 70’s or jam to the new funky beats of Shaggy and Sean Paul. If you are a reggae music enthusiast, you can enjoy any of the several free online reggae radio stations. You can also listen to exclusive interviews of well-known artists. Most of the songs available on the Internet are in the MP3 format, enabling your media player to play it. However, some sites require you to download special software to listen to the songs. You can search for free radio stations on the Internet.
There are over 3000 online reggae radio stations worldwide. Some online sites also give you the option of creating your own personalized reggae radio station, where you can tune into your favorite reggae artists. You could choose between rock-steady, dub, dance hall or jungle music.
